3: φωνη βοωντος εν τη ερημω ετοιμασατε την οδον κυριου ευθειας ποιειτε τας τριβους αυτου— edit Textus Receptus
3: The voice of one crying in the wilderness, Prepare ye the way of the Lord, make his paths straight.- edit KJV text
3: A voice of one crying in the desert: Prepare ye the way of the Lord; make straight his paths.— edit Douay text


φωνὴ βοῶντος ἐν τῇ ἐρήμῳ, Ἑτοιμάσατε τὴν ὁδὸν κυρίου, εὐθείας ποιεῖτε τὰς τρίβους αὐτοῦ, [WHNU]

A voice of one crying in the desert, ‘Prepare the way of the Lord, make his paths straight’.”

  • βοῶντος is a substantival participle.
  • Ἑτοιμάσατε is aorist imperative while ποιεῖτε is present imperative, but we must be careful not to overtranslate what is admittedly a subtle distinction.
